CO2 measurement in the winery laboratory and in the cellar

  • Portable 3658 instrument - up to 40 hours of independent operation in the cellar, isolated from mains supply
  • No reagents - safe and easy operation
  • Fast method - temperature compensated analysis provides readings in two minutes or less
  • Unmatched ease of operation - no sample preparation or wine transfer from the initial location
  • Universal method for all wine - covers the entire range of wines: still, fizzy wines and Champagnes
  • Selective measurement - no influence of color or interference from other dissolved gases or compounds
  • Wide analysis range - highly sensitive, from 0.01 g/kg up to 12 g/kg
  • Long lasting calibration - the calibration lasts for more than one month (in gas or liquid phase)
  • Dual use - In the cellar, directly from a line, a tank, or a barrel, or with an optional piercer for lab analysis
  • Non-destructive method - the sample can be used for other analyses
  • Small wine sample (150 mL)
  • Minimal flow requirement
  • Can be connected after an Orbisphere 3650 oxygen analyzer
